Default "ROARVETTE" '64 Corvette Coupe Garage Built

Many of you have seen some of my photos on this web-site since 2005. I am at the stage of begining paint and have a completed rolling chassis all nice and ready to drop the body on. I have had this car for 5 years, and if you have any doubt how things change, my son Rocky in the photos is now driving and is 6 feet tall!
Over the next few weeks, I will post the entire project for those of you that are into that sort of thing.
The saga begins with this "prime" piece of Corvette history. A 64 coupe sitting on a 67 chassis which had been a drag car for many years. From the looks of the welding on the frame, it probably had a solid rear at some point as well as a cage.
The body had only minor issues for what was basically a basket case. The chassis was also solid. But let's not kid ourselves here, it was basically a 40 Year Old POS.
But since I am cursed with a vivid imagination I thought it looked great...
